Ella Martinez never planned to hire a fake boyfriend. But when her perfect little sister’s wedding turns into a judgmental family reunion, desperate times call for desperate apps. Enter PlusOne: charming, discreet, and offering a five-star "boyfriend experience."
Her rental? Sebastian — handsome, mysterious, and alarmingly good at pretending they’re in love.
For seventy-two hours, Ella and Sebastian fake laughs, fake kisses, and the kind of chemistry that’s way too convincing. But as champagne flows and secrets surface, the line between real and pretend begins to blur.
Now the girl who rented a romance might be falling for a man she barely knows. And the billionaire who never planned to get involved? He might just break his own rules.
Smart, funny, and filled with heart, Billionaire for Rent is a slow-burn romantic comedy about fake love, real feelings, and the mess in between.
